Cultivation & Care:
Growing this beauty is remarkably easy. As a member of the Proteaceae family, ‘Granya Glory’ is generally low-maintenance and resilient. Here are some key points to consider for its care:
- Sunlight: ‘Granya Glory’ thrives in full sun, receiving at least 6 hours of sunlight daily. This condition helps promote healthy growth and abundant flowering.
- Soil: Well-drained soil is essential for this plant. Avoid heavy clay soils, as they can lead to root rot. Aim for a sandy or loamy soil that allows water to drain freely.
- Watering: ‘Granya Glory’ prefers consistent moisture but dislikes soggy roots. Water regularly during hot, dry spells, allowing the soil to dry slightly between waterings.
- Pruning: Pruning is minimal for this shrub. Prune after flowering to encourage a more compact, bushier habit.
- Fertilization: While not essential, occasional fertilization with a balanced fertilizer can help enhance the growth and flowering of ‘Granya Glory’.
Where to Plant:
‘Granya Glory’ is versatile, making it an excellent choice for various gardening scenarios:
- Border Plant: The shrub’s compact size and vibrant flowers make it a fantastic addition to mixed borders.
- Container Plant: This Grevillea excels in large pots or containers, adding a splash of color to your patio or balcony.
- Specimen Plant: Allow ‘Granya Glory’ to shine as a solitary specimen plant, showcasing its remarkable foliage and flowers.
- Native Garden: Embrace the beauty of Australian native plants by integrating ‘Granya Glory’ into your native garden.
